Why Do You Need to Reset Your TPMS?

The Tire Pressure Monitoring System is designed to alert you when your tire pressure is below a certain threshold, typically 25% below the recommended pressure indicated on the sticker inside your driver’s side door. However, there are several situations where you might need to manually reset the TPMS:

  • Tire Inflation: After inflating your tires to the correct pressure, the TPMS light might remain on until you reset the system. This is because the system needs to relearn the new pressure readings.

  • Tire Rotation: Rotating your tires changes their position, and the TPMS sensors need to be recalibrated to reflect the new locations. A reset ensures the system accurately displays the pressure for each tire.

  • Tire Replacement: When you replace your tires, especially if the TPMS sensors are also replaced or moved, you’ll need to reset the system to register the new sensors.

  • Temperature Fluctuations: Significant changes in temperature can affect tire pressure. A cold snap, for example, can cause the pressure to drop, triggering the TPMS light. Once you’ve adjusted the pressure, a reset is necessary.

  • False Alarms: Occasionally, the TPMS light might illuminate due to a sensor malfunction or a temporary glitch. A reset can sometimes clear the false alarm.

Ignoring the TPMS light can lead to driving with underinflated tires, which reduces fuel economy, increases tire wear, and can even lead to tire blowouts. Therefore, understanding how to reset your TPMS is essential for responsible car ownership.

Common Locations for the TPMS Reset Button

The location of the TPMS reset button is not standardized across all vehicles. It varies significantly based on the manufacturer and model year. Some vehicles don’t even have a physical button, relying instead on the car’s infotainment system or an automatic relearn procedure. Here are some of the most common locations:

Glove Compartment

One of the most frequent locations for the TPMS reset button is inside the glove compartment. It’s often a small, recessed button labeled “TPMS” or a similar abbreviation. You may need to open the glove compartment completely and look towards the back or sides to find it.

Under the Steering Wheel

Another common area is underneath the steering wheel, near the dashboard. The button might be located on the lower dashboard panel, often near other buttons related to vehicle settings. You might need to get down and look up to spot it.

In the Center Console

Some vehicles have the TPMS reset button located in the center console, either on the dashboard or within the console compartment itself. Check around the gear shifter, cupholders, and other controls in the center console area.

Near the Fuse Box

In some cases, the TPMS reset button might be located near the fuse box, which is usually under the dashboard on the driver’s side or in the engine compartment. You may need to consult your owner’s manual to identify the exact location of the fuse box and the TPMS reset button nearby.

Infotainment System

Many newer vehicles have integrated the TPMS reset function into the infotainment system. You’ll need to navigate through the menus on the touchscreen display to find the TPMS settings and the reset option. This is becoming increasingly common in modern cars.

Resetting Your TPMS: Step-by-Step Instructions

Before attempting to reset your TPMS, ensure that all your tires are inflated to the correct pressure, as indicated on the sticker inside your driver’s side door. Use a reliable tire pressure gauge to verify the pressure in each tire. Once you’ve confirmed the tire pressures, follow these steps to reset your TPMS, depending on whether you have a physical button or not:

Resetting with a Physical TPMS Button

If your car has a dedicated TPMS reset button, follow these steps:

  1. Park your car: Park your car on a level surface.
  2. Turn the ignition on: Turn the ignition key to the “on” position, but do not start the engine.
  3. Locate the TPMS reset button: Find the TPMS reset button in one of the locations mentioned earlier (glove compartment, under the steering wheel, center console, or near the fuse box).
  4. Press and hold the button: Press and hold the TPMS reset button until the TPMS warning light on the dashboard blinks a few times. This usually takes about 3-5 seconds.
  5. Start the engine: Start the engine and drive the car for about 10-20 minutes. This allows the TPMS sensors to recalibrate and learn the new tire pressure readings. The TPMS light should turn off after the system has relearned the tire pressures.

If the TPMS light remains on after following these steps, there might be an issue with one or more of the TPMS sensors, or there could be a problem with the TPMS system itself. In this case, it’s best to consult a qualified mechanic.

Resetting Through the Infotainment System

If your car doesn’t have a physical TPMS reset button, you’ll likely need to reset the system through the infotainment system. The exact steps will vary depending on the make and model of your car, but here’s a general guide:

  1. Turn the ignition on: Turn the ignition key to the “on” position, but do not start the engine.
  2. Access the settings menu: Navigate to the settings menu on your infotainment screen. This is usually done by pressing a “Menu,” “Settings,” or “Car” button.
  3. Find the TPMS or tire pressure settings: Look for a section related to TPMS, tire pressure, or vehicle settings. The exact wording will vary depending on the car’s manufacturer.
  4. Select the reset or calibration option: Within the TPMS settings, you should find an option to reset, calibrate, or relearn the tire pressures. Select this option.
  5. Follow the on-screen prompts: The system may provide on-screen prompts or instructions. Follow these instructions carefully.
  6. Drive the car: After initiating the reset, drive the car for about 10-20 minutes to allow the TPMS sensors to recalibrate. The TPMS light should turn off once the system has relearned the tire pressures.

Consult your car’s owner’s manual for specific instructions on how to reset the TPMS through the infotainment system. The manual will provide detailed step-by-step guidance tailored to your specific vehicle.

Automatic TPMS Relearn Procedure

Some vehicles have an automatic TPMS relearn procedure, meaning you don’t need to press any buttons or navigate through any menus. The system automatically recalibrates itself after you inflate the tires to the correct pressure and drive the car for a certain period.

  1. Inflate tires: Inflate all tires to the recommended pressure.
  2. Drive the vehicle: Drive the vehicle for a specified distance or time. Usually, driving for 10-20 minutes at a speed above 20 mph is sufficient.
  3. System recalibrates: The TPMS system will automatically relearn the tire pressures as you drive. The TPMS light should turn off once the process is complete.

Refer to your owner’s manual to determine if your car has an automatic TPMS relearn procedure and to learn the specific requirements for the relearn process.

Troubleshooting TPMS Issues

Even after resetting the TPMS, you might still encounter issues with the system. Here are some common problems and potential solutions:

  • TPMS light stays on: If the TPMS light remains on after resetting the system, it could indicate a faulty TPMS sensor, a leak in one of the tires, or a problem with the TPMS module.
  • Flashing TPMS light: A flashing TPMS light usually indicates a malfunction in the TPMS system itself. This could be due to a dead sensor battery, a broken sensor, or a problem with the TPMS receiver.
  • Inaccurate pressure readings: If the TPMS displays inaccurate pressure readings, the sensors might need to be recalibrated or replaced.
  • Sensor not detected: If one or more sensors are not being detected by the system, it could be due to a dead sensor battery, a damaged sensor, or interference from other electronic devices.

If you’re experiencing any of these issues, it’s best to consult a qualified mechanic. They can diagnose the problem and recommend the appropriate solution. They may need to use a specialized scan tool to read the TPMS data and identify any faulty sensors or components.

Maintaining Your TPMS for Optimal Performance

To ensure your TPMS functions correctly and provides accurate readings, follow these maintenance tips:

  • Check tire pressure regularly: Check your tire pressure at least once a month and before long trips. This will help you identify leaks and maintain optimal tire pressure.
  • Use a reliable tire pressure gauge: Use a high-quality tire pressure gauge to ensure accurate readings.
  • Replace TPMS sensors when necessary: TPMS sensors have a limited lifespan, typically around 5-7 years. Replace the sensors when they reach the end of their lifespan or when they start malfunctioning.
  • Have your tires rotated regularly: Rotating your tires helps to ensure even wear and tear and can also help to prolong the life of the TPMS sensors.
  • Consult a professional: If you’re unsure about any aspect of your TPMS, consult a qualified mechanic. They can provide expert advice and assistance.

By following these tips, you can keep your TPMS in good working order and ensure that it provides accurate and reliable tire pressure readings, helping you to stay safe on the road and maintain optimal fuel efficiency. What is a TPMS reset button, and why would I need to use it?

A TPMS reset button allows you to recalibrate your car’s Tire Pressure Monitoring System (TPMS) after adjusting tire pressure, rotating tires, or replacing a TPMS sensor. The system relies on a baseline reading to accurately monitor tire pressures, and sometimes, a manual reset is needed to establish this new baseline after changes have been made.

Without resetting the TPMS, the warning light might stay illuminated even after correcting the tire pressure issue. This can be due to the system retaining old pressure data. Resetting essentially tells the system to learn the current tire pressures as the new normal, clearing the warning light and allowing the TPMS to function accurately.

Where is the TPMS reset button typically located in a car?

The location of the TPMS reset button varies depending on the make and model of your vehicle. Common locations include inside the glove compartment, under the steering wheel near the dashboard, in the center console, or near the fuse box. The owner’s manual is the best resource to find the precise location of the TPMS reset button in your specific vehicle.

If you cannot locate a physical reset button, your vehicle may have a TPMS reset function accessible through the infotainment system or the vehicle’s settings menu. Navigating through the menu options can often reveal a TPMS reset or calibration option. Consult your owner’s manual for detailed instructions on using the infotainment system to reset the TPMS.

How do I reset the TPMS if there’s no physical reset button?

If your car lacks a dedicated TPMS reset button, you will likely need to use the vehicle’s infotainment system or driver information center to initiate the reset. Navigate through the menus, looking for options related to vehicle settings, tire pressure, or TPMS. The precise steps will vary depending on the car’s make and model, so consulting your owner’s manual is essential.

Another common method involves adjusting tire pressures to the recommended levels (as indicated on the tire placard, typically found on the driver’s side doorjamb) and then driving the vehicle for a certain period, often around 10-20 minutes, at a speed above a certain threshold (e.g., 25 mph). This allows the TPMS to automatically relearn the tire pressures, effectively resetting the system.

What are the steps for performing a TPMS reset using a physical button?

The exact procedure might differ slightly depending on your vehicle, but the general steps for resetting the TPMS with a physical button are usually the same. First, ensure all tires are inflated to the recommended pressure (check the tire placard). Next, turn the ignition to the “on” position, but do not start the engine. Locate the TPMS reset button and press and hold it until the TPMS light on the dashboard flashes several times.

After the light flashes, release the button. Start the engine and drive the vehicle for at least 10 minutes at a speed above 25 mph. This allows the TPMS sensors to transmit their data to the control module, and the system relearns the tire pressures. The TPMS warning light should then turn off, indicating a successful reset.

What can cause a TPMS light to stay on even after a reset attempt?

If the TPMS light remains illuminated after attempting a reset, there could be several underlying issues. One common cause is a faulty TPMS sensor in one or more of the tires. These sensors have a limited lifespan and may need replacement if their battery is depleted or if they are damaged.

Another possibility is that one or more tires have a slow leak, causing the pressure to drop below the TPMS threshold even after inflation. Other potential problems include a malfunctioning TPMS module, interference with the TPMS signal, or incorrect tire pressure settings. A diagnostic scan with a TPMS tool can help pinpoint the exact cause of the persistent warning light.

Is it safe to drive with the TPMS light on?

Driving with the TPMS light illuminated presents potential safety concerns. The primary function of the TPMS is to alert you to underinflated tires, which can significantly affect vehicle handling, braking performance, and fuel efficiency. Underinflated tires are also more susceptible to blowouts, especially at higher speeds.

While driving short distances to a tire repair shop or mechanic is generally acceptable, prolonged driving with an active TPMS warning is not recommended. It’s crucial to address the underlying issue as soon as possible to ensure safe and optimal vehicle performance. Ignoring the warning light increases the risk of tire damage and potentially dangerous driving situations.

When should I consult a professional mechanic regarding my TPMS?

If you’ve attempted to reset the TPMS and the warning light persists, or if you suspect a faulty TPMS sensor, seeking professional assistance is recommended. Mechanics have specialized tools, such as TPMS diagnostic scanners, that can identify the specific problem and determine which sensor, if any, needs to be replaced.

Additionally, if you’re unsure about the proper tire pressure or the reset procedure for your specific vehicle model, a mechanic can provide expert guidance and ensure the TPMS is functioning correctly. Trying to force a reset when there’s an underlying mechanical issue can potentially damage the TPMS module or other related components, so professional intervention is often the best course of action.
